A clerk at the butcher shop is six feet tall and wears size 10 shoes. What does he weigh?
Meat. He works at the butcher shop, so he weighs meat for a living.
What is as light as a feather, but even the world’s strongest man couldn’t hold it for more than a minute?
His breath
Bobby throws a ball as hard as he can. It comes back to him, even though nothing and nobody touches it. How?
He throws it straight up.
How do you make the number one disappear?
Add the letter G and it’s “gone”
What is so delicate that saying its name breaks it?
Silence
What has a head but never weeps, has a bed but never sleeps, can run but never walks, and has a bank but no money?
A river
What gets wetter as it dries?
A towel
What has a neck but no head?
A bottle
A monkey, a squirrel, and a bird are racing to the top of a coconut tree. Who will get the banana first, the monkey, the squirrel, or the bird?
None of them, because you cannot get a banana from a coconut tree!
What word begins and ends with an E but only has one letter?
Envelope
People buy me to eat, but never eat me. What am I?
A plate
If an electric train is travelling south, which way is the smoke going?
There is no smoke
Why would a man living in New York not be buried in Chicago?
Because he is still living
What goes up but never goes down?
Your age
If a blue house is made out of blue bricks, a yellow house is made out of yellow bricks and a pink house is made out of pink bricks, what is a green house made of?
Glass
What has a face and two hands but no arms or legs?
A clock
What ship has two mates, but no captain?
A relationship
